<html>
<head>
<meta charset="utf-8">
<title>完成左移右移</title>
<script src="jquery.js"></script>
<style type="text/css">
table{background-color:purple;}
input{background-color:blue;}
</style>
<script language="javascript">
$("document").ready(function(){
$("#b1").click(function(){
var v1=$("#k1").find("option:selected").text();
if(v1!=null){
$("#k2").append("<option value=''>"+v1+"</option>");
$("#k1 option:selected").remove()
}
}); $("#b2").click(function(){
var v2=$("#k2").find("option:selected").text();
if(v2!=null){
$("#k1").append("<option value=''>"+v2+"</option>");
$("#k2 option:selected").remove();
}
});
});
</script>
</head>
<body>
<form action="#" method="post">
<table>
<tr>
<td>
<select id="k1" size="10" style="width:200px;">
<option id="p1">柠檬学院</option>
<option id="p2">柠檬学员</option>
<option id="p3">柠檬人</option>
</select>
</td>
<td>
<input type="button" id="b1" value=">>"/>
<input type="button" id="b2" value="<<"/>
</td>
<td>
<select id="k2" size="10" style="width:200px;">
<option>李哥</option>
</select>
</td>
</tr>
</table>
</form>
</body>
</html>

 <html>
<head>
<meta charset="utf-8">
<title>完成左移右移</title>
<script src="jquery.js"></script>
<style type="text/css">
table{background-color:purple;}
input{background-color:yellow;}
</style>
<script language="javascript">
$(document).ready(function(){
$("#b1").click(function(){
$("#k2").append($("#k1 option:selected"));
}); $("#b2").click(function(){
$("#k1").append($("#k2 option:selected"));
}); $("#b3").click(function(){
$("#k2").append($("#k1 option"));
}); $("#b4").click(function(){
$("#k1").append($("#k2 option"));
}); $("#add0").click(function(){
var a=$("#add").val();
$("#k1").append("<option value="+a+0+">"+a+"</option>");
$("#add").val("");
});
});
</script>
</head>
<body>
<form action="#" method="post">
<table>
<tr>
<td>
<select id="k1" size="10" style="width:200px;">
<option value="Ning1" id="p1">柠檬学院</option>
<option value="Ning2" id="p2">柠檬学员</option>
<option value="Ning3" id="p3">柠檬人</option>
</select>
</td>
<td>
<input type="button" id="b1" value=">>"/>
<input type="button" id="b3" value="==>>"/><br/>
<input type="button" id="b2" value="<<"/>
<input type="button" id="b4" value="<<=="/> </td>
<td>
<select id="k2" value="Ning4" size="10" style="width:200px;">
<option>李哥</option>
</select>
</td>
</tr>
</table>
</form>
内容:<input type="text" id="add"/>
<input type="button" value="添加" id="add0"/> </body>
</html>

jQuery实现左移右移的更多相关文章

  1. select多选左移右移的实现

    <html> <head> <meta http-equiv="Content-Type" content="text/html; char ...

  2. EASYUI- EASYUI左移右移 GRID中值

    EASYUI左移右移 GRID中值 $("#addAll").click(function(){ var ids = []; var names = []; var srcrows ...

  3. 【转载】c语言数据的左移右移

    原文地址:http://www.cnblogs.com/myblesh/articles/2431806.html 由于在飞控程序中执行效率对程序的影响相当大,所以一个好的运算效率很重要.左移右移比单 ...

  4. 嵌入式C开发---用循环实现左移右移

    //将n左移m位 int byte_to_left_move(int n , int m) { int i , ret = 1 ; if(n == 0 || n < 0) { return ; ...

  5. python 左移右移 2个数交换

    左移右移的能够使得数字*2或者/2 那*3怎么办,就左移一位然后再+ 经典面试题: 1.交换2个数,不用temp   a=10  b=12 1.1 a = a + b = 22 b = a - b = ...

  6. JAVA 基础编程练习题32 【程序 32 左移右移】

    32 [程序 32 左移右移] 题目:取一个整数 a 从右端开始的 4-7 位. 程序分析:可以这样考虑: (1)先使 a 右移 4 位. (2)设置一个低 4 位全为 1,其余全为 0 的数.可用~ ...

  7. 【C#】关于左移/右移运算符的使用

    吐槽先~为什么我的老师大学时候没教过我这东西  - -. 继续送栗子: 比如 “(1+2)<<3” 你们猜等于几~ Debug.Log((1+2)<<3)之后输出的是“24”. ...

  8. jquery以及js实现option左移右移

    <table cellspacing="1" width="350px" align="center"> <tr> ...

  9. java左移右移运算符

    http://blog.csdn.net/dandanteng/article/details/7433531 首先要明白一点,这里面所有的操作都是针对存储在计算机中中二进制的操作,那么就要知道,正数 ...

随机推荐

  1. C# 使用js正则表达式,让文本框只能输入数字和字母,最大长度5位

    使用js正则表达式,让文本框只能输入数字和字母,最大长度5位,只需要加个onkeyup事件,即可简单实现 <asp:TextBox ID="txtBegin" runat=& ...

  2. IOS单例模式要做到3点

    1,永远只分配一块内存来创建对象. +(instanst) static id instace = nil; static dispatch_once_t onceToken; dispatch_on ...

  3. javascript arguments与javascript函数重载

    1.所 有的函数都有属于自己的一个arguments对象,它包括了函所要调用的参数.他不是一个数组,如果用typeof arguments,返回的是’object’.虽然我们可以用调用数据的方法来调用 ...

  4. php中文截取无乱码方法

    直接使用PHP函数substr截取中文字符可能会出现乱码,主要是substr可能硬生生的将一个中文字符“锯”成两半.解决办法: 1.使用mbstring扩展库的mb_substr截取就不会出现乱码了. ...

  5. Intellij IDEA 根据数据库自动生成pojo和hbm

    新建一个项目,每次写hibernate部分,就觉得pojo和hbm.xml部分很蛋疼.今天搜索了半天,终于知道如何根据数据库自动生成了. Intellij IDEA14创建maven时并不能勾选各种支 ...

  6. Jade之Doctype

    Doctype jade: doctype html html: <!DOCTYPE html>

  7. c#winform如何通过控件名查找控件

    //根据控件名称查找控件 //作用根据控件的配置项目, Control[] myfindcs = this.Controls.Find("button4", true); if ( ...

  8. Java 入门 代码2浮点数据类型

    /** * 基本数据类型之浮点类型 */ public class DataTypeDemo2 { public static void main(String[] args) { double d1 ...

  9. Android Studio安装genymotion模拟器

    1.Genymotion的安装: Genymotion无疑是目前最快最好用的模拟器.官网下载地址:https://www.genymotion.com/ 先注册,然后下载,安装VirtualBox最简 ...

  10. 使用代码在windows-store中打开、搜索应用程序

    //Launcher.LaunchUriAsync(newUri("ms-windows-store:PDP?PFN=" + Package.Current.Id.FamilyNa ...